Output 63be494e5ffd82aceb49a17c6ab22e7f74f54a60e98e9fcb1a53421fbf4b3de8:1

value
1038979
script pubkey
OP_0 OP_PUSHBYTES_20 af20dbc91628197b2f5d19d2cad7e0ee5e4b0789
address
bc1q4usdhjgk9qvhkt6ar8fv44lqae0ykpufcfevu5
transaction
63be494e5ffd82aceb49a17c6ab22e7f74f54a60e98e9fcb1a53421fbf4b3de8
confirmations
67771
spent
true